So here's how the A to Z challenge works for us:
1. You can write (100 words or more) or make graphics for the letter of the week.
2. You choose the topic! As long as it starts with that week’s letter.
3. Post on your Journal, on your AO3, on your body if you dare - as long as you link the post with a word count in that week’s post.See easy-peasy. You can write about your favorite H50 guys. You can do originals. You can write love poems to your cat. You can write about how great I am. As long as it’s following that week’s letter. We will be going in order so you can preplan your posts now.

We're heading towards the end of our first GLORIOUS year, and to celebrate, we'd like to hold a word swap. An exchange of gifts between the bunch of us that have been wording our hearts out working toward our goal. Sure it makes us more words, but it's also a way to say thank you and yay you to the folks who've had your back while they've been shaking their pom-poms!
REQUIREMENTS
Written word gifts should be at least 1,000 words.
Image gifts should be wallpaper/banner/multiple icons.A very rough idea is that I (kaige68) can write a few drabbles in an hour, 1,000 words in 4 hours, so image making people should be looking at roughly 4 hours of work towards their gift (It really is hard to make figure out a 'graphic equivalent').
POSTING
Gifts should be ready to be posted between December 15th and 20th (You will be allowed to post at your convenience).(Open, Unmoderated)
